“Would recommend Den Laman and Bonaire Dive and Adventure”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 30 December 2010

I am writing this from Den Laman, our last night in Bonaire. We have been here two weeks. The rooms are comfortable (except for the furniture in the LR; truly awful), the views from the ocean front rooms are gorgeous. The ocean view rooms have a better view of the parking lot, but if you lean waaay out you can see the water. Sort of. Another reviewer mentioned the office staff and the way the maids made the beds/ both comments are true. Sheets were not tucked in on top (too short) and we woke up on the mattress pad. Also the woman in the front office seemed very nice but rather demeaning, answering questions with sort of a "you should know this already" attitude. It got to the point where I would not interact with her, let my dive buddy (a man) work with her. Internet was intermittent; from the ocean front rooms extremely bad, from the rooms in the back of the hotel the connection was better, assuming they had it turned on.

We dove with Bonaire Dive and Adventure for the second year. I totally enjoyed the dive staff; they went out of their way to help me, to the point of carrying tanks and lifting my tank and BC out of the water so I could climb the ladder. Both years we got to the point of wanting to adopt them and take them home. On busy days the boat was very crowded, handled well but boat is too small for a group of 15 divers. We did mostly boat diving, also doing the Bari Reef in front of the dive shop a few times. Getting out of the water in a surge was hard; banged up my camera on the stairs; that could be made a lot easier with a little work.
The entire area, condos, and dive shop could use a lot of updating. The road into it was barely passable after a rainstorm left about 3 inches of water on the already broken up road. The women in the office of the dive shop were borderline surly; giving me a vacant stare if I asked for something, a huge contrast to the friendly and capable divemasters.
I rate this hotel and dive operation as far better than Buddy Dive.
One additional comment; we hired VIP divers to take us on a dive under Salt Pier. I highly recommend them.

“We had a great time!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 28 December 2010

This was our fourth trip to Bonaire and our first time staying with Den Laman. We usually stay at Sand Dollar next-door, but were looking for something a little less expensive. The Den Laman studios were very clean with modern appliances and decor. They provide nice big beach towels, and clean your room and freshen up your towels and linens everyday. It was so nice to come back to a clean room after a day of diving.

Unlike some of the other reviews, we have always enjoyed Bonaire Dive and Adventure, which is the dive shop connected with Den Laman and Sand Dollar. The staff is always helpful and friendly. There is always plenty of Nitrox and Air available and dunk tanks to rinse your gear. They also keep coolers filled with water around to keep people from getting dehydrated. If you're with someone who doesn't dive they offer kayaking, bike tours and more. Can't beat it.

We will definetly stay at Den Laman during our next visit to Bonaire!

“Great place but avoid the bonaire dive and adventure”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ed 30 September 2010
1
person found this review helpful

We had a great time staying in Den Laman Condominium. Rooms were very nice and clean and the staff was very helpfull. No complains about Den Laman.

The only major drawback was that it seemed logic to use the services of Bonaire Dive and Adventures. Please don't. The briefing they give was okay, though a bit long, but after that we met they owner who doesn't seem to enjoy diving, customers or life in general and enjoys being as rude as possilbe to see how far he can go with customers.
He yeld as us for not knowing the exact size of our wetsuits and the weights we needed.
Since we are novice divers, we just were nog sure. That seemed enough to get him very mad at us.
We did one dive with this dive school and left for a Bonaire Dive Friends. Here people seem to enjoy diving and care about customers. Please do yourself a favor, do not dive with Bonarie Dive and Adventures.
